Abstract
Dandelion is a herbal plant recorded in the China Pharmacopoeia of a People's Republic. It contains useful chemical constituents or active ingredients with pharmacological activities, such as anti-inflammatory, anti-viral, and antibacterial properties. Since COVID-19 has happened for over three years, there is no reasonable treatment up to the display. This brief commentary introduces the knowledge of dandelion, the background of COVID-19, and dandelion's mechanisms of pharmaceutical activities because it may be a conceivable candidate for combating SARS-CoV-2.
